Kelsey Fields (she/her) is a multifaceted artist from the D.C. Metro area. She began dancing at the age of three and went on to train in competitive dancing. Kelsey graduated from Northwestern University with a Bachelor of Science in Materials Science and Engineering. During her collegiate years, she was a member of Tonik Tap, Northwestern's premier tap group. She served as Artistic Director of Tonik Tap her senior year while under the mentorship of Billy Siegenfeld. Kelsey is an alumna of The School at Jacob's Pillow Creating in Jazz Program, directed by LaTasha Barnes. She teaches at dance studios across the Chicagoland area. Kelsey is thrilled to continue her tap dance journey with M.A.D.D. Rhythms.
